Can Beckett's playwriting techniques be applied to science fiction writing?
Yes, his use of minimal settings. Science fiction can benefit from this. Instead of always having elaborate alien landscapes, a simple, desolate setting like in Beckett's plays can enhance the mood. It can focus the reader's attention on the characters and their internal struggles in a new, perhaps extraterrestrial, context.

What is the difference between 'canada storey' and 'canada story'?
A'storey' is related to architecture in Canada. For instance, when you talk about the height of a building in terms of the number of storeys it has. But 'story' is more about the telling of something. If you say 'a story from Canada', it could be a folktale, a personal experience, or a news report about Canada.
